Popup mit einstellungen

  • Antworten:0
Alexander R.
  • Forum-Beiträge: 1.148

06.07.2010, 17:20:19 via Website

Hallo,
wie kann man eine Art Popup oder Alert machen, indem man verschiedene Einstellungen machen kann wie bei der AP-App unter "Einstellungen"?
Auch mit Checkbox und so

Bisher habe ich folgenden Code:

1final boolean[] states = {false, false, true};
2 final CharSequence[] items = {"Zoom"};
3 AlertDialog.Builder builder3 = new AlertDialog.Builder(this);
4 builder3.setTitle("Einstellungen");
5 builder3.setMultiChoiceItems(items, states, new DialogInterface.OnMultiChoiceClickListener(){
6 public void onClick(DialogInterface dialogInterface, int item, boolean state) {
7 Toast.makeText(getApplicationContext(), items[item] + " set to " + state, Toast.LENGTH_SHORT).show();
8 }
9 });
10 builder3.create().show();

jetzt möchte ich dass wenn "Zoom" is checked dass er dann

1//Zoom
2 FrameLayout mContentView = (FrameLayout) getWindow().
3 getDecorView().findViewById(android.R.id.content);
4 final View zoom = this.webview.getZoomControls();
5 mContentView.addView(zoom, ZOOM_PARAMS);
6 zoom.setVisibility(View.GONE);
7 //Zoom

zeigt wenn es jedoch nicht gechecked ist soll ers ausblenden wie kann ich das machen?

— geändert am 06.07.2010, 17:54:19

Gruß Alexander

Antworten